After presenting strong evidence and counterarguments, it is time to wrap up your argumentative

essay with a powerful conclusion. This final section of your essay is crucial as it leaves a lasting
impression on the reader and reinforces your main points.

First and foremost, your conclusion should restate your thesis statement and summarize the main
points you have made throughout the essay. This reminds the reader of your main argument and
helps them understand how you have supported it with evidence.

Next, you can use this opportunity to address any opposing viewpoints that you have not yet
addressed in the essay. This shows that you have considered different perspectives and strengthens
your argument by acknowledging and refuting counterarguments.

Furthermore, you can use your conclusion to leave a lasting impact on the reader by providing a call
to action or a thought-provoking statement. This encourages the reader to think further about the
topic and potentially take action based on your argument.
